Welcome back to my podcast, Kritical Moments, where we dive into the science and soul of feeling good.

I’m your host, Kriti, and today we’re talking about something that touches every part of our mental and emotional life—SLEEP.

Sleep isn’t just about closing your eyes and drifting off. It’s sacred. It’s a healing process. It’s the moment your brain gets to recharge, reset, and restore.

But here’s the problem—many of us, especially students, are walking through life sleep-deprived, foggy, and emotionally frayed.

So today, we’re going to explore what makes sleep so important for mental health, what really happens when we don’t get enough of it, and how you can take back control of your sleep habits and start feeling like yourself again.
